Home Tags San Francisco Giants

Tag: San Francisco Giants

MOST COMMENTED

the 2021 Fantasy Football waiver wire in this article!

0
American people's love for football games is immense. However, their national sport is Baseball. But it did not make them love watching football any...

HOT NEWS